Maybe it would be easier to convince me that this isn't what they're doing if EA hadn't done it before. This game bears all the markings of an EA intentional flop:

• inferior version of an existing product: check. Even if the trilogy wasn't happening, I haven't found anywhere confirmation, or even a mention, that the Wii U version will be supported with post-release DLC. Sure, it comes with From Ashes packed-in, but will Wii U players ever get to play Leviathan, Omega, or future DLC adventures? We still don't know, but it doesn't sound like they will!

• bad release date: check. last month it was reported to be a launch title for Wii U, but now it doesn't appear on Nintendo's official list of day one games. Pushed back to avoid potentially decent Black Friday sales? Maybe. Maybe it's still a launch title, which just means EA isn't doing a good job of spreading the word, as even Nintendo doesn't know the game's coming out. Again, either way, this release is at best two weeks after that of Mass Effect Trilogy for 360.

• inexperienced development studio: check. Surely EA cares enough about this game, one of their only Wii U games planned for a launch window release, to put a good, respected team on the job? Nope, they're just making a port after all, let's get that Australian team whose entire resume consists of a single Need for Speed port to iOS. What experience! Surely they can come up with some amazing, innovative uses of the GamePad, and make a very high-quality product!

• no advertising: It's early to call this one. But there has been a distinct lack of hype for Mass Effect 3 for Wii U. EA had no presence at Nintendo's conference this past E3 to discuss their game (unlike Ubisoft and Warner Bros), simply dropping the title into the sizzle reel of Wii U games with no explanation. They had no presence at the Wii U press event earlier this month to discuss their game (unlike Activision). I'm pretty sure the only time we've seen ME3 on Wii U was at EA's summer showcase. Maybe there was a demo at the press event, but if there was, I can't find it.

Speaking of the summer showcase, EA spent a fair amount of time there justifying their Wii U games being inferior to the PS360 versions, something no other studio has had the gall to do.
